When the churning is finished the butter is gathered with a strainer and washed well with cold water till all the buttermilk is completely washed out of it. Then it is salted and made into prints or pound rolls with the "Wooden Fingers".
About three take part in the churning as it is not at all easy and sometimes takes as long as an hour to do it. The buttermilk is used for a lot of purposes. It is given to young calves and pigs and some people take it with porridge. It is said that if you take a drink of water when helping with the churning it is a great drawback to the formation of the butter and t here will be very little yield on the milk.
